Output 2590328da65e08ff231ce10b43222cc40bc184a414941061a70c4ec12eeebb20:1

value
34177456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ee452f113a6bbaf7f6a3ab91aa5a18fdf2936970 OP_EQUALVERIFY OP_CHECKSIG
address
Lgwoxr6WtiWsBBsxtx83NLCseNhxRgwSK6
transaction
2590328da65e08ff231ce10b43222cc40bc184a414941061a70c4ec12eeebb20
spent
true